There are a couple trouble spots on the EXI that are cheap ixes... the flybar is soft as a noodle and the tailbox is troubles too... The tailbox I replaced after it failed with a metal box, grips and a belt for $20.00... cheap fixes for a smooth heli...
underdog... you can buy HiTec 65 servos for $20.00 a piece, a xmseller G401b gyro for $36.00 and the GL-WS2632 3500 brushless moto w/fan for $23.00.. assuming you have the Rx to go with ur 6i...
The Hitec may be the last servo's you have to buy because you can get gearsets for them and these are great servos... The gyro everyone is now talk'n about is the g401b which people are say'n holds better than the Telebee and its cheaper...
